Fix previous commit

This commit is contained in:
Evgeny Khramtsov 2019-11-24 16:26:03 +03:00
parent de91618070
commit 910f6aa290
1 changed files with 3 additions and 1 deletions

View File

@ -116,8 +116,10 @@ process_iq(#iq{from = From, to = To} = IQ, Source) ->
Access = mod_register_opt:access_remove(Server),
Remove = case acl:match_rule(Server, Access, From) of
deny -> deny;
allow when From#jid.lserver /= Server ->
deny;
allow ->
check_access(From#jid.luser, From#jid.lserver, Source)
check_access(From#jid.luser, Server, Source)
end,
process_iq(IQ, Source, IsCaptchaEnabled, Remove == allow).